Adam Pavey is a Partner in the Employment Team at Ronald Fletcher Baker, specialising in tribunal litigation, strategic HR advisory work, and complex workplace disputes, including discrimination and whistleblowing claims.

Adam advises a broad range of clients, from SMEs to senior executives and business owners, on the full spectrum of employment law issues. He is particularly experienced in handling high-stakes and sensitive matters, including unfair dismissal, discrimination, and senior exits, often where reputational risk is a key concern. He is regularly instructed to represent clients in the Employment Tribunal and has a strong track record of achieving successful outcomes in contentious proceedings.

Alongside his litigation practice, Adam works closely with businesses to provide proactive, commercial HR advice, helping clients navigate disciplinaries, grievances, restructures, and day-to-day workplace challenges. Known for his pragmatic and strategic approach, Adam focuses on resolving disputes efficiently while protecting his clients’ commercial interests. He is often viewed as a trusted advisor by his clients, providing clear, actionable advice in complex and fast-moving situations.
